I've got a 5 X 1 double array that looks like this;
>> Y = [1;2;3;4;5];
>> Y
Y =
1
2
3
4
5
I want to format the contents of Y such that they are;
01
02
03
04
05
Can this be done for an array of values? I've used fprintf for writing formatted data to text file. But it appears this won't work for an array.

Y = [1;2;3;4;5]
out=sprintf('0%d\n',Y)

Or considering numbers >= 10:
Y = [1;2;3;4;5;10]
out = sprintf('%02d\n',Y)
